Fairmonts 2019 Food Day Canada Menu Released

July 18, 2019

Whistler, BC – In June, Fairmont Chateau Whistler executive sous chef Derek Bendig announced that his 2019 Food Day Canada (FDC) dinner will be comprised entirely of ingredients from the Whistler Farmer’s Market, located just steps from the hotel’s front doors. Today chef Bendig released the complete menu ahead of the August 3, 2019 dinner.

The Whistler Farmer’s Market welcomes local farmers, purveyors, artisans, bakers, and entrepreneurs twice-weekly. From Lillooet’s Spray Creek to Squamish’s Spark Kombucha, the local product of countless market partners will be showcased on the seven-course menu under the creative cookery of Chef Bendig.

*N’Quatqua Rainbow Trout

  • romanesco, radish, peas, turnip, rooftop nasturtium, smoked trout velouté

Rainshadow Collective Padron Peppers

  • stuffed with Golden Ears Neufchatel, Salt Spring island herb salt, fried zucchini blossoms

Spray Creek Ranch Pork

  • stuffed trotter with green pea pureé, guanciale wrapped pork loin with horseradish turnip pureé, cabbage wrapped crepinette with carrot and rooftop honey pureé

Alpine Fireweed & Rhubarb-Spruce Tip Granité

  • Pemberton Distillery Elderflower Liqueur

Spray Creek Ranch Pasture Raised Chicken

  • chicken breast sous vide, leg meat, offal, Pemberton potato ragu, crisp skin, poached egg

Spray Creek Rose Veal Chuck

  • cooked 24 hours, kale and morel mushroom cream, Madeira jus, kale chip

Cherry On The ‘Honey’ Cake

  • Goldstrike honey, AIG summerland cherries, Bowen Island herb smoked salt, powdered raspberries ginger-berry kombucha pearls

Like last year, each course will paired with wine from Penticton’s Roche Wines, which is dedicated to natural, artisanal farming and winemaking.

*The only product not currently available at the Whistler Farmer’s Market is N’Quatqua Rainbow Trout.
